Furnace Turns On and Off Too Often

If your furnace cycles off and on too frequently, the problem is likely to be with the thermostat—especially with a combustion furnace. See "Thermostats" for information on repairing this problem.

When an electric-resistance furnace or heat pump turns off and on too frequently, the problem may be that the unit is overheating because of a clogged filter or blower that is malfunctioning. Try cleaning or replacing the filter. If that doesn't do the trick, call a furnace repair technician.
